In 395 B.C. As the Roman Empire began to lose its control to barbarians and armies across Europe, the Middle East and North Africa, you have the chance to save the empire by repelling attacks or your enemies in your various provinces for 12 turns attack. Each round corresponds to five years and is divided into three phases:

* Income and expense phase:
Here you look at each province and receive money from each province, with the number of enemy tribes and armies in the area influencing the amount. You have the choice to convert your mobile legions into other troops or move money to other provinces.

* Movement:
Here you move your armies through the provinces, and when you're done, the computer moves the enemies' tribes and armies.

* Battle:
Here you can attack your enemies to keep them in order or reduce their numbers.
